WebA Pt resistance thermometer is to be used to measure temperature. The relationship between resistance and temperature is to be given by the following equation: If R o = 100 Ω, R 100 = 138.50 Ω, and R 200 = 175.83 Ω, determine: (a) the value of the constants A and B; (b) the fundamental interval. 2. In 1901 the writer t showed that a great number of facts in connection with the negative ionisation from hot metals could be explained by supposing that WebThe relationship governing the net radiation from hot objects is called the Stefan-Boltzmann law: Calculation. While the typical situation envisioned here is the radiation from a hot object to its cooler surroundings, the Stefan-Boltzmann law is not limited to that case. If the surroundings are at a higher temperature (T C > T) then you will ... Webmechanism of the action by which the positive ions set free by hot bodies originate.
